LINCOLN, Neb. (KLKN) – Lincoln Public Schools announced three new elementary school principals for Cavett, Humann and Wysong.

“These established school leaders have proven through their service to be dedicated to the success of students,” said LPS Associate Superintendent for Instruction Matt Larson. “We know they will build upon the legacy already established in each building and continue the pursuit of excellence for their students.”

Cavett Elementary School:

Kathleen Dering, the principal at Elliott Elementary School since 2013, will replace Jeff Vercellino at Cavett.  Vercellino was selected by LPS to be the first principal at the new Ada Robinson Elementary School. Dering was previously the principal at Beattie Elementary School and also worked in Oklahoma as a principal, assistant principal and teacher.

Humann Elementary School: 

Jamie Cook, the principal at Pershing Elementary School since 2017, will replace Sharon Eickhoff at Humann. Cook previously served as a coordinator, an instructional coach and a teacher at other LPS schools.  Cook takes over for Sharon Eickhoff, who was selected to be the assistant principal at Ada Robinson Elementary School.

Wysong Elementary School: 

Stephanie Drake, the principal at Morley Elementary School since 2018, will replace Randy Oltman at Wysong.  Oltman announced his retirement earlier this year.  Drake served as assistant principal at Wysong before coming into her current position.  She also served as a coordinator and teacher at other LPS schools.
